Abstract
A list of tachinids (Diptera, Tachinidae) of the southeastern European part of Russia comprising 74 species is given. Eight species (Bithia jacentkovskyi, Estheria bohemani, Zeuxia nudigena, Stomina iners, Opesia descendens, Labigastera pauciseta, Cylindromyia rufifrons, Besseria reflexa) are for the first time recorded from Russia, three species (Acemya rufitibia, Atylomyia loewi, Crapivnicia donabilis), from the European part of Russia, and 25 species, from the southeastern European part of Russia. The male of Crapivnicia donabilis Richter found in Astrakhan Province is described. The genus Crapivnicia Richter is assigned to the tribe Goniini, based on the examination of the abdomen of C. donabilis female from Kalmykia which has shown the presence of dark microtype eggs.
